Output 6912e990269a643c29e2b28a96a53487178a33eafa123ea76a60d7a8d216d56a:1

value
8858103
script pubkey
OP_0 OP_PUSHBYTES_20 ec1bc91a567e6bcb829bcd99e0918b797b2854aa
address
bc1qasdujxjk0e4uhq5mekv7pyvt09ajs49206vgs6
transaction
6912e990269a643c29e2b28a96a53487178a33eafa123ea76a60d7a8d216d56a
spent
true